Description

80 Days  |  Flat broad glossy green pods measure 8″-10″ long with 4-6 beans each. Plants average 24″-36″ tall semi-bushy. Seed is greenish brown with black eye. Also called an English or Broad bean, Fava beans are cool weather crops that can be planted weeks before other, more sensitive beans. Also a strong nitrogen fixer and cover crop, Fava are good for those tired parts of your garden.

6-12 days to sprout

Fava bean seeds per packet: About 30

Fava bean seeds per 1/2 Lb: About 125

Fava bean seeds per Lb: About 250

Plant as soon as soil can be comfortably worked, spacing the rows about 4′ apart with plants 4″-6″ apart in the rows. Because of the higher cold tolerance, Fava do not fear late frosts the same way most beans do, and as such will have pods ready nearly the same time as an “early” bush bean.
